Read moreMy Partner and I had dinner here on a very quiet Saturday evening. We were seated outside which was fine as we were overlooking the River, however we did feel as though we were being cooked alive what with the overhead heaters which were on for whatever reason unbeknownst to us. It was only 19°C outside.
To start, we had the Bug Bon Bons with Honey Mustard Sauce and the Tuna Crudo which was Sashimi Grade Tuna ‘Ribbons’ with Crushed Tomatoes, Almond Cream, Olive & Capers. We thoroughly enjoyed both of these dishes.
For our Mains, my Partner had the Mushroom Agnolotti with Parmesan Sauce, Rocket Pesto & Shaved Almonds. The portion size was absolutely minuscule. My Partner was shocked at the pitiful serving size, given it had a $42.00 price attached to it and the taste was quite average. Nothing noteworthy.
I had the Wagyu Striploin MBS 4-5 with Roasted Cauliflower Puree & Florets and a side of Twice Cooked Fries. Regrettably the Fries were the only truly enjoyable thing present. The Striploin was barely warm and the amount of gristle I had to remove was very disappointing, especially as it had been served already cut in several pieces and so whomever prepared it would have seen the amount of sinew on this steak and yet still thought it was okay to serve.
Despite the aforementioned, our servers were very kind and attentive.
Total cost of the evening was $236.00
Personally I feel the prices at Lucio’s do not reflect the quality and quantity you are served. The atmosphere and service perhaps but definitely not the quality and quantity. Given that it is also located in Tewantin and NOT in Noosa should also be reflected in the pricing.
